Transaction 6b942672935bc35dec39bbb17d93725a660b108bb7f0a867a46548cfc099b46d
1 Input
1 Output
-
6b942672935bc35dec39bbb17d93725a660b108bb7f0a867a46548cfc099b46d:0
- value
- 17975766
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 95f1c5425d212bbafe87f513f534ab1a1e97111813bb5462739b00002edb3b82
- address
- bc1pjhcu2sjayy4m4l5875fl2d9trg0fwygczwa4gcnnnvqqqtkm8wpqq98jas